What have you just finished recently?

So I finally finished Runemarks last weekend, it did take a while to read it but I did it. I have already written a book review on Monday if you are interested in reading. But I will keep it brief here.

This book follows Maddy, she is known in her village with a strange mark on her hand. She discovers about magic in a world where magic is no longer accepted. She befriends a traveller named One-Eye who tasks her to find The Whisperer and along the way she learns more about the past, herself and what to look forward to in the future.

This was a nice book to get back into, while it did take me a while to finish it, it felt more like reading the book as new because it had been so long since I read it. If you are ever interested in Norse Mythology themed books then you should definitely try this series.
